By size

Tile flooring installation by floor area: Carrollwood Village vs Miami

Tile is priced around $7–$25/sq ft for a complete installed job — labor-heavy because of mortar, leveling, grouting, and cuts. Intricate patterns and large rooms with many cuts push the per-square-foot cost up.

Editors' roundtable

How should you budget a flooring project?

A flooring budget is really two budgets — the material on top and the subfloor work underneath. Our editors break down the trade-offs.

The longevity case

Solid hardwood costs more but can be refinished for decades and adds resale value. If you're staying put, the higher upfront price amortizes well.

The hidden-cost case

The surprise isn't the flooring — it's the subfloor. Budget for leveling, removal and disposal; a bid that ignores them will be "revised" mid-job.

The material-value case

Laminate and luxury vinyl deliver a hardwood look for a fraction of the price and handle moisture better — the value pick for busy homes and tight budgets.

Our take

The material decision should follow your timeline and traffic level; the budget decision should always include the subfloor. Skipping that line is the single costliest mistake in a flooring job.
